It is therefore the maximum value for … A 32-bit register can store 2 different values. The range of integer values that can be stored in 32 bits depends on the integer representation used. With the two most common representations, the range is 0 through 4,294,967,295 (2 − 1) for representation as an (unsigned) binary number, and −2,147,483,648 (−2 ) through 2,147,483,647 (2 − 1) for representation as two's complement.
